Michigan and Washington Push Regulatory Reform to Balance Innovation and Accountability

Lawmakers Advance Crypto Clarity with State and Federal Bills

Legislative efforts in the United States are gaining momentum as both state and federal lawmakers take significant steps to bring greater clarity and structure to cryptocurrency regulation. In Michigan, a package of four proposed bills is moving through the legislative process, targeting digital asset rights, environmental reform, and public sector investment in crypto. Simultaneously, lawmakers in Washington, D.C. have reintroduced a bill aimed at clarifying the obligations of blockchain developers and non-custodial service providers under federal law.

These legislative developments reflect a broader shift in political intent to accommodate digital innovation while ensuring legal safeguards and regulatory accountability. The overarching goal appears to be the establishment of a coherent policy framework that enables growth in the decentralized finance sector without compromising consumer protection or market integrity.

Michigan Embraces Regulated Crypto Exposure and Green Mining

Among the proposed legislation in Michigan, House Bill 4510 has emerged as a pivotal component. This bill seeks to permit state-managed pension funds to invest in cryptocurrencies, but only through regulated financial instruments like exchange-traded funds (ETFs). These investment vehicles would be subject to strict requirements, including market capitalization thresholds and regulatory oversight by financial authorities. The proposal is being viewed as a cautious but progressive step to offer inflation-resistant and diversified assets to public retirement systems.

In a novel intersection of environmental remediation and digital finance, Michigan legislators have also introduced House Bills 4512 and 4513. These measures propose an energy reuse initiative involving decommissioned oil and gas wells, which would be repurposed to power Bitcoin mining operations. Participation in the program would require miners to undertake site remediation and adhere to environmental reporting protocols. In return, qualifying miners would be eligible for income tax deductions.

This approach aims to position Michigan as a forward-thinking state that encourages responsible crypto mining while addressing legacy pollution. The proposed bills explicitly focus on Bitcoin and utilize the concept of “orphan well programs” as a mechanism to align economic incentives with environmental goals.

Digital Rights and CBDC Restrictions Take Center Stage

Another bill in the Michigan package, House Bill 4511, is designed to protect the rights of cryptocurrency users within the state. It aims to prevent local and state authorities from implementing discriminatory regulations, licensing requirements, or special taxes that target digital assets solely based on their digital format. The bill also seeks to prohibit any state agency from supporting or promoting central bank digital currencies (CBDCs), effectively creating a legal distinction between decentralized cryptocurrencies and government-issued digital money.

This proposal has been interpreted as a robust stance in defense of decentralized finance, offering legal protections to miners, node operators, and digital asset holders from arbitrary regulatory targeting. If passed, Michigan’s legal framework could serve as a model for other states considering similar protections.

Federal Legislation Targets Developer Clarity

At the federal level, efforts to bring regulatory certainty to the blockchain industry have also resumed. U.S. Representatives Tom Emmer and Ritchie Torres have reintroduced the Blockchain Regulatory Certainty Act. The bill is intended to delineate which entities should be classified as “money transmitters” under U.S. law. Specifically, it aims to exempt blockchain developers and non-custodial service providers—those who do not directly control consumer funds—from financial licensing obligations.

The bill is being promoted as a safeguard against overregulation and an essential step to prevent the migration of blockchain talent and innovation to jurisdictions with more favorable policies. Lawmakers involved in the bill have emphasized the importance of distinguishing between those who build blockchain protocols or offer access interfaces and those who actually manage or store digital assets on behalf of users.

The federal measure is seen as a response to longstanding concerns about regulatory uncertainty and enforcement inconsistency in the blockchain space. By establishing a clear legal boundary between developers and custodians, the bill aims to foster innovation while maintaining appropriate oversight where consumer assets are involved.

Together, these state and federal initiatives mark a significant effort to define the future of cryptocurrency in the United States, balancing innovation with regulatory responsibility.
